Concrete vibrating device capable of detecting gesture and pressure
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of concrete vibration molding, in particular to a concrete vibration device capable of detecting gesture and pressure.
Background
The vibration is a key step in concrete construction, coarse aggregate can be uniformly distributed, the additive and the slurry are fully reacted, and air bubbles in fresh concrete are discharged, so that the compactness and impermeability of the whole concrete in the later stage are improved.
In the vibrating process, the attitude control of the vibrator becomes the key for realizing the vibrating quality of a special part, if an attitude sensor and a pressure sensor are added on the vibrating rod, corresponding angle data and pressure data can be detected, but the vibrating rod is severely vibrated in a working state, so that the attitude sensor and the pressure sensor cannot actually reflect the insertion state (such as the depth of concrete) of the vibrating rod.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ention provides a concrete vibrating device capable of detecting the gesture and the pressure, which aims to solve the technical problem that a gesture sensor and a pressure sensor cannot be directly applied to a vibrating rod because the vibrating rod is severely vibrated in a working state.

The embodiment is shown in fig. 1-6, and the concrete vibrating device capable of detecting the gesture and the pressure comprises a vibrating rod 100, and further comprises a gesture sensing module 200 and a pressure sensing module 300, wherein the pressure sensing module 300 is arranged at the bottom end of the vibrating rod 100, the gesture sensing module 200 is arranged in the vibrating rod 100, and the vibrating rod 100 is vertically inserted into the concrete.
The working mechanism of the vibrating device provided by the embodiment is as follows:
the vibrating rod 100 is a main body part of the device and is responsible for transmitting vibration energy into concrete so as to eliminate bubbles in the concrete, improve the compactness and uniformity of the concrete, and the attitude sensing module 200 installed in the vibrating rod 100 can sense the angle of the vibrating rod 100, so that the control of the vibrating process is facilitated, the pressure sensing module 300 at the bottom of the vibrating rod 100 detects the pressure at the bottom of the vibrating rod 100, and along with the insertion depth of the vibrating rod 100, the pressure value detected by the pressure sensing module 300 is increased, so that whether the vibrating rod 100 is positioned in the deep part or the shallow part of the concrete can be obtained.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
The posture sensing module 200 includes a mounting frame 210, the mounting frame 210 is connected to the vibrating rod 100, and a fiber optic gyroscope 201 is connected to the middle of the mounting frame 210.
The posture sensing module 200 includes a fiber optic gyroscope 201, the fiber optic gyroscope 201 is installed in the vibrating bar 100 through a mounting frame 210, and a posture angle of the vibrating bar 100 is detected through the fiber optic gyroscope 201.
Regarding the structure of the posture sensing module 200, specifically:
The gesture sensing module 200 further comprises two fixing plates 220, the two fixing plates 220 are respectively arranged on the upper portion and the lower portion of the optical fiber gyroscope 201, a connecting rod 231 is connected between the two fixing plates 220, the connecting rod 231 is inserted into the mounting frame 210, and springs 233 are sleeved on the upper side and the lower side of the connecting rod 231, which are located on the mounting frame 210.
When the vibrating rod 100 works, axial vibration is transmitted to the optical fiber gyroscope 201 and the two fixing plates 220, so that the two fixing plates 220 drive the connecting rod 231 to slide on the mounting frame 210, the spring 233 is compressed, and the spring 233 relieves the vibration transmitted to the optical fiber gyroscope 201.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
The gesture sensing module 200 further includes eight first piston cylinders 230 connected to four corners of the two fixing plates 220, a cylinder-shaped piston rod 232 is slidably connected in each of the eight first piston cylinders 230, two ends of a connecting rod 231 are respectively connected to the two first piston cylinders 230 symmetrically arranged up and down, an outer wall and an inner wall of the cylinder-shaped piston rod 232 are respectively attached to the inner wall of the first piston cylinder 230 and the outer wall of the connecting rod 231, two ends of a spring 233 are respectively abutted to the cylinder-shaped piston rod 232 and the mounting frame 210, when the reciprocating sliding frequency of the connecting rod 231 relative to the mounting frame 210 is increased, the cylinder-shaped piston rod 232 slides towards the outer direction of the first piston cylinder 230 to compress the spring 233, and accordingly the reciprocating sliding stroke of the connecting rod 231 is reduced.
The upper fixing plate 220 and the lower fixing plate 220 are fixedly connected through the first piston cylinder 230 and the connecting rod 231, when the vibration frequency is increased, the cylinder-shaped piston rod 232 slides out of the first piston cylinder 230, so that the length of the spring 233 is compressed, the deformation degree increasing amount of the spring 233 is reduced, the thrust of the spring 233 to the mounting frame 210 is increased, the sliding stroke of the optical fiber gyroscope 201 relative to the mounting frame 210 is reduced, the supporting force of the spring 233 to the optical fiber gyroscope 201 is ensured to be increased along with the vibration frequency of the optical fiber gyroscope 201, and the damping effect of the optical fiber gyroscope 201 is ensured.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
The gesture sensing module 200 further includes two second piston cylinders 260, the two second piston cylinders 260 are respectively disposed on the upper and lower sides of the optical fiber gyroscope 201 and fixedly connected with the inner wall of the vibrating rod 100, the two fixing plates 220 are connected with cylindrical piston rods 280, the two cylindrical piston rods 280 slide in the second piston cylinders 260 respectively, when the connecting rod 231 slides reciprocally, the second piston cylinders 260 inject air into the first piston cylinders 230, the first piston cylinders 230 discharge injected air outwards, and when the reciprocating sliding frequency of the connecting rod 231 increases, the air injection speed is higher than the air injection speed of the first piston cylinders 230 discharge injected air outwards, so that the cylindrical piston rods 232 slide outwards to compress the springs 233.
The vibration generated when the vibrating rod 100 operates causes the two fixing plates 220 to axially fluctuate, thereby driving the cylindrical piston rod 280 to reciprocally slide inside the second piston cylinder 260, the second piston cylinder 260 extracts air through the air extraction pipe 270, and air is injected into the first piston cylinder 230 through the air exhaust pipe 250, so that the cylindrical piston rod 232 slides out of the first piston cylinder 230 under the influence of air pressure, and the length of the spring 233 is compressed.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
The second piston cylinder 260 is connected with an exhaust pipe 270 and an exhaust pipe 250, the exhaust pipe 250 and the exhaust pipe 270 are respectively provided with a one-way valve, the exhaust pipe 250 is communicated with the first piston cylinder 230, the first piston cylinder 230 is connected with a pressure release pipe 240, and the pressure release pipe 240 is provided with a pressure valve.
In order to prevent the cylinder-type piston rod 232 from extending out of the first piston cylinder 230 without limitation, a pressure release pipe 240 is further connected to the first piston cylinder 230, and a flow limiting valve or a pressure valve is provided to the pressure release pipe 240, so that air entering the first piston cylinder 230 can be discharged, and when the vibration frequency of the vibration rod 100 increases, the sliding speed of the cylindrical piston rod 280 relative to the second piston cylinder 260 increases, and at this time, the air intake amount of the first piston cylinder 230 is greater than the air exhaust amount, so that the cylinder-type piston rod 232 can maintain a state of sliding out of the first piston cylinder 230, and when the vibration frequency of the vibration rod 100 is low, the air intake amount of the first piston cylinder 230 is less than the air exhaust amount, so that the compression degree of the spring 233 is low, and the stroke of the optical fiber gyroscope 201 is not excessively reduced.
Regarding the structure of the pressure sensing module 300, specifically:
The pressure sensing module 300 includes a flexible PZT composite film pressure sensor 310, and a lower pressing frame 311 and an upper pressing frame 330 are respectively connected to the upper portion and the lower portion of the flexible PZT composite film pressure sensor 310, and the lower pressing frame 311 and the upper pressing frame 330 are respectively attached to the outer wall and the inner wall of the vibrating rod 100.
The lower pressing frame 311 and the upper pressing frame 330 and the flexible PZT composite film pressure sensor 310 can be mounted by nuts, so that the flexible PZT composite film pressure sensor 310 is convenient for disassembly and assembly and later maintenance.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
A sealing ring 320 is arranged between the pressing frame 311 and the vibrating rod 100.
The sealing ring 320 isolates the inner and outer spaces of the vibrating rod 100 and prevents concrete from flowing into the vibrating rod 100.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
The lower surface of the upper pressing frame 330 is connected with a rectangular air bag 340, and the rectangular air bag 340 is attached to the inner wall of the vibrating rod 100.
In the alternative of this embodiment, it is preferable that:
The four pressure release pipes 240 at the lower part are all communicated with the rectangular air bag 340, when the sliding frequency of the connecting rod 231 increases, the pressure release pipes 240 inject air into the rectangular air bag 340 to further expand the rectangular air bag 340, and the rectangular air bag 340 is provided with a pressure valve.
The first piston cylinder 230 of lower part is through pressure release pipe 240 and rectangle gasbag 340 intercommunication, thereby first piston cylinder 230 exhaust air enters into rectangle gasbag 340 and makes rectangle gasbag 340 inflation promote and goes up pressure frame 330 and move, go up pressure frame 330 and drive flexible PZT composite film pressure sensor 310 and move up for the extrusion degree of frame 311 to sealing washer 320 down increases, also set up the pressure valve on the rectangle gasbag 340, prevent that rectangle gasbag 340 from excessively expanding and breaking, guarantee that flexible PZT composite film pressure sensor 310 contacts the concrete, make it accurate collection pressure data, still further promote the leakproofness of vibrating rod 100 lower part.
